Tips For Natural Pest Control In The Home.

It is possible to use effective pest control methods in the home. This combines natural deterrents, physical barriers, and targeted treatments to manage insects and animals around your home and garden.

Here are some natural & eco-friendly pest control ideas for inside the home.

  • Essential oil sprays: Mix 2 cups of water, 1 cup of white vinegar, and 50 drops of peppermint essential oil to spray near doorways and entry points to deter ants and flies.
  • Potted herbs: Place fresh basil or mint pots near doors and windows to naturally repel flying insects.
  • DIY fruit fly traps: Fill a small jar with apple cider vinegar and a few drops of dish soap to catch fruit flies.
  • Diatomaceous earth: Sprinkle a light food-grade barrier of diatomaceous earth along baseboards or entry points to deter crawling bugs.

Here are some natural methods for garden pest control.

  • Encourage beneficial insects: Plant flowers like fennel, dill, and yarrow to attract ladybirds and lacewings that eat garden pests.
  • Physical barriers: Use insect netting over delicate vegetable beds to block birds, caterpillars, and larger pests.
  • Homemade sprays: Mix soapy water for aphids, or combine crushed garlic and chili powder with water to deter chewing insects.
  • Slug and snail controls: Set out shallow beer traps or use organic iron-chelate pellets around vulnerable plants.

Pest Maintenance and Exclusion

  • Seal entry points: Caulk cracks around windows, doors, and utility pipes to stop rodents and insects from getting inside.
  • Manage yard perimeters: Keep mulch and woodpiles at least 30 cm to several meters away from your home’s foundation to prevent termites and ants from moving indoors.
